Playground improvements
At Turners Hill Recreation Ground, the new climbing frame and in ground roundabout are now open and available for play! The old bark pit has been cleared and replaced with a surface that is more easily accessible. We have also recently completed the installation of a new half pipe for older children to practice their skating, scootering and BMXing.
Improvements at St Andrews Play Area in Burgess Hill have been completed and the new equipment is open for use. We have installed a new toddler playhouse and slide, a new junior climbing frame and slide, a spinny bowl and a set of swings. There are a variety of swing seats to suit different ages and abilities together with new trees and other plants.
We will be starting work to improve Forest Fields Play Area in Haywards Heath this summer. We plan to carry out further consultation with local residents before installing a new climbing frame, large seesaw and toddler slide and improving accessibility with new surfacing.
Looking forward to the rest of the financial year, we are planning to improve another two play areas, one at Hollands Way Play Area in East Grinstead and one at The Dolphin Leisure Centre in Haywards Heath. We are also working in partnership with Pyecombe Parish Council to try and secure some external funding so we can upgrade the play area at The Wyshe over the next couple of years.
